Medical Breakthrough

In a groundbreaking procedure, doctors at Vinmec Times City International Hospital successfully reconstructed a patient’s chest wall using custom 3D-printed titanium implants.
Smart Design
The innovative implant, created through VinUniversity’s 3D Technology in Medicine Centre, features an integrated mesh design that guards against lung hernia complications.

This advancement marks a significant improvement over traditional methods that required muscle-skin flap transfers and often left substantial scarring.
Rapid Recovery
The medical team’s combination of cutting-edge 3D technology and specialized ESP pain management led to remarkable results – the patient returned home after just five days.

The procedure targeted an 11.5 cm mediastinal tumor.
